Well, Dr. Fred Humphries was definitely the best president that FAMU has had since at least the Civil Rights Era. He had vision and clout. Just like our own Dr. Harold Martin honed his skills at WSSU, Humphries was able to sharpen his skills at Tennessee State before going to Tallahassee. In Nashville, he had to fight off a sure-thing merger with UT-Nashville. In fact, he was able to turn the tide back on them...Tennessee State ended up absorbing UT-Nashville instead of the other-way-around.
Humphries' downfall was that he had too much influence with key Black leaders around the state for the White Establishment's taste, IMHO. The last straw was when FAMU was named Time Magazine's College of the Year. They had to find a way to get him outta there. An additional factor is how states university systems are setup. In Florida, they did not separate the technical and engineering schools from the liberal arts schools, UF has everything and therefore under separate but equal FAMU was supposed to have everything, but after FSU transitioned from a women’s school the program snatching from FAMU started.
